Jerry Stackhouse is a πΊπΈ Forward for the Detroit Pistons. Drafted in 1995, round 1, pick 3, from North Carolina. During the 2001 season, his season stats include 29.8 points, 3.9 rebounds and 5.1 assists per game, with a 52.1 true shooting percentage.
